Andy Jennings Presley, 76, passed away peacefully at his home in Harrisville, Mississippi, on Saturday, January 25, 2025. Born July 16, 1948, in Brandon, Mississippi, Andy spent most of his life in Harrisville, where he had resided since 1977.

Andy graduated from Forest Hill High School in 1966. A dedicated and hardworking man, he retired after 33 years with BellSouth, where his commitment and professionalism left a lasting legacy. He proudly served his country in the United States Navy and the Mississippi Air National Guard. A skilled marksman, Andy was a decorated member of the Air National Guard Rifle Team and the State of Mississippi Rifle Team, earning numerous trophies that reflected his passion and talent.

Andy loved the outdoors, finding great joy in hunting and fishing. These hobbies, along with his natural skills and adventurous spirit, brought him lifelong happiness. He was a devoted member of Harrisville Baptist Church, where his faith served as the foundation of his life.
